Gifts and toys with la differenza
by Paisleypaul about Al Sogno
Al Sogno is at the top of Piazza Navona. There are gifts such as ornaments and framed art work and also children's toys, a welcome break from the chain store banality of Toys 'R' Us. Large jointed mannequins abound, but my favourite was the giant soft toy camel, 2 Metres tall and maybe 75 Kg. If you have to take this back with you on the plane somewhere, start preparing your story now ! Just contain yourself ! Could buy the shop ! (in the wish sense - not the wealth sense!) Nothing seemed especially cheap here !
Great meat!
by marielexoteria about T-bone Station
Mr. Sweden and I always look for a good meat place in every city we visit, and I found T-bone Station after googling for days and using different keywords.
T-bone Station has a variety of meat, salads, ribs, etc. and gave me a feel of an American steakhouse, probably the same feeling I've had in any other good meat place I have visited, but with an Italian twist. Their prices are average, and this had me a little bit worried because their online menu doesn't have any prices, but their food is excellent and the staff was accommodating and patient with me for trying to speak Italian (and I don't). We were very satisfied.
Coffee in Campo de' Fiori
by sue_stone about Il Nolano
Il Nolano is one of the many restaurant/bars situated on the vibrant Campo de' Fiori.
We stopped off here mid shop and took a seat in the square to relax and top up on caffeine.
It was a sunny day and a great place to do some people watching and plan our next activity.
